Description
each modelled in the form of quail standing on gilt-bronze legs and talons, the rounded head turned to the side, with the gilt-bronze beak slightly open and eyes in widened expression, the body enamelled in turquoise with the plumage in shades of blue, yellow, green, red, white and black (2)
